Bedburg Sunshine Hours by Month
When exploring climate, sunlight hours tell an important story. This page shows the total number of hours of direct sunlight per month and the average hours per day in Bedburg, North Rhine-Westphalia, Germany. These averages rely on historical data collected over 30 years, from 1990 to 2020.
Monthly hours of sunshine
Sunshine in Bedburg varies greatly throughout the year. The sunniest month, July, reaches an impressive 209 hours, while December, the darkest month, offers only 45 hours. The total annual amount of sun is 1604 hours.
Daily hours of sunshine
Seasonal changes in sunshine hours are quite obvious in Bedburg. While July receives considerable daily sunshine with up to 7.0 hours, December marks the darkest time of the year, where sunshine is scarce with only 1.5 hours of sunlight per day.

Related Climate Data for Bedburg
December, Bedburg’s wettest month, receives 75 mm (3 in) of rainfall and has a maximum daytime temperature of 8°C (46°F). During the driest month April you can expect a temperature of 16°C (61°F).
